Output ac15d16341500ef9bc30e98fb9f73bf945dca211561a545afaf25f87e786611b:23

value
99084
script pubkey
OP_0 OP_PUSHBYTES_20 c621c799eaa2f530f88e3d0c31e31ddb6470eb07
address
bc1qccsu0x025t6np7yw85xrrccamdj8p6c87x0tua
transaction
ac15d16341500ef9bc30e98fb9f73bf945dca211561a545afaf25f87e786611b